#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""Fill coverImage URLs in web/data/books.json via Open Library search."""

from __future__ import annotations

import json
import re
import time
import urllib.error
import urllib.parse
import urllib.request
from concurrent.futures import ThreadPoolExecutor, as_completed
from pathlib import Path

ROOT = Path(__file__).resolve().parents[1]
BOOKS_PATH = ROOT / "web" / "data" / "books.json"
CACHE_PATH = ROOT / "scripts" / ".cover_cache.json"
UA = "FreeProgrammingBooksCoverBot/1.0 (github.com/EbookFoundation; cover lookup)"
COVER_ID_TMPL = "https://covers.openlibrary.org/b/id/{cover_id}-L.jpg"
COVER_ISBN_TMPL = "https://covers.openlibrary.org/b/isbn/{isbn}-L.jpg"
MAX_WORKERS = 5
REQUEST_PAUSE = 0.15


def load_json(path: Path, default):
if path.exists():
return json.loads(path.read_text(encoding="utf-8"))
return default


def save_json(path: Path, data) -> None:
path.write_text(json.dumps(data, indent=2, ensure_ascii=False) + "\n", encoding="utf-8")


def normalize(text: str) -> str:
text = text.lower()
# Common programming-title normalizations
repl = {
"c++": "cpp",
"c#": "csharp",
"f#": "fsharp",
"javascript": "java script",
"typescript": "type script",
"objective-c": "objective c",
"node.js": "nodejs",
"node js": "nodejs",
".net": "dotnet",
"asp.net": "aspnet",
}
for a, b in repl.items():
text = text.replace(a, b)
text = re.sub(r"[^\w\s]", " ", text)
text = re.sub(r"\s+", " ", text).strip()
# Collapse java script -> javascript for comparison consistency after split words
text = text.replace("java script", "javascript")
text = text.replace("type script", "typescript")
return text


def title_core(title: str) -> str:
# Drop subtitle / series noise.
t = re.split(r"[:–—|(]", title, maxsplit=1)[0]
t = re.sub(
r"\b(series|volume|vol\.?|part|edition|ed\.?)\b.*$",
"",
t,
flags=re.I,
)
return normalize(t).strip()


def edition_tokens(edition: str) -> set[str]:
ed = normalize(edition or "")
tokens: set[str] = set()
m = re.search(r"(\d+)\s*(st|nd|rd|th)?\s*edition", ed)
if m:
tokens.add(f"{m.group(1)} edition")
year = re.search(r"\b(19|20)\d{2}\b", ed)
if year:
tokens.add(year.group(0))
return tokens


def http_get_json(url: str) -> dict:
req = urllib.request.Request(url, headers={"User-Agent": UA, "Accept": "application/json"})
with urllib.request.urlopen(req, timeout=30) as resp:
return json.loads(resp.read().decode("utf-8"))


def cover_exists(url: str) -> bool:
# Open Library returns 404 when default=false and cover missing.
check = url + ("&" if "?" in url else "?") + "default=false"
req = urllib.request.Request(check, method="HEAD", headers={"User-Agent": UA})
try:
with urllib.request.urlopen(req, timeout=20) as resp:
return 200 <= resp.status < 400
except urllib.error.HTTPError as exc:
return exc.code != 404
except Exception: # noqa: BLE001
return False


def search_openlibrary(query: str, mode: str = "q") -> list[dict]:
params = urllib.parse.urlencode({mode: query, "limit": 20})
url = f"https://openlibrary.org/search.json?{params}"
data = http_get_json(url)
return data.get("docs") or []


def word_overlap(a: str, b: str) -> float:
aw = set(a.split())
bw = set(b.split())
if not aw or not bw:
return 0.0
return len(aw & bw) / max(len(aw), 1)


def score_doc(doc: dict, book_title: str, edition: str, require_cover: bool = True) -> int:
if require_cover and not doc.get("cover_i"):
return -1
score = 5
doc_title = doc.get("title") or ""
nt = normalize(book_title)
nd = normalize(doc_title)
tc = title_core(book_title)
dc = title_core(doc_title)

if nd == nt or dc == tc:
score += 60
elif tc and (tc in nd or nd in nt or dc in nt):
score += 40
else:
overlap = max(word_overlap(tc, dc), word_overlap(nt, nd))
if overlap < 0.45:
return -1
score += int(overlap * 30)

# Penalize clearly unrelated programming-adjacent collisions a bit less harshly
# but drop obvious fiction false positives when query is technical.
fiction_markers = ("sherlock", "tale of two", "harry potter", "pride and prejudice")
if any(m in nd for m in fiction_markers):
return -1

ed_tokens = edition_tokens(edition)
for tok in ed_tokens:
if tok and tok in nd:
score += 20
break

score += min(int(doc.get("edition_count") or 0), 25) // 5
if doc.get("cover_i"):
score += 5
return score


def isbn_candidates(doc: dict) -> list[str]:
out: list[str] = []
for key in ("isbn",):
vals = doc.get(key) or []
if isinstance(vals, list):
for v in vals:
s = re.sub(r"[^0-9Xx]", "", str(v))
if len(s) in (10, 13):
out.append(s)
# Prefer ISBN-13
out.sort(key=lambda x: (0 if len(x) == 13 else 1, x))
# unique preserve order
seen = set()
uniq = []
for x in out:
if x not in seen:
seen.add(x)
uniq.append(x)
return uniq[:6]


def pick_cover_url(docs: list[dict], book_title: str, edition: str) -> str:
ranked = sorted(
((score_doc(d, book_title, edition, require_cover=False), d) for d in docs),
key=lambda x: x[0],
reverse=True,
)
for score, doc in ranked:
if score < 0:
continue
cover_i = doc.get("cover_i")
if cover_i:
return COVER_ID_TMPL.format(cover_id=int(cover_i))
# Fallback: ISBN cover endpoint
for isbn in isbn_candidates(doc):
url = COVER_ISBN_TMPL.format(isbn=isbn)
if cover_exists(url):
return url
return ""


def query_variants(title: str) -> list[str]:
variants = [title]
core = re.split(r"[:–—|(]", title, maxsplit=1)[0].strip()
if core and core not in variants:
variants.append(core)
# Strip trailing Series / Handbook noise
stripped = re.sub(r"\b(Series|Collection)\b", "", core, flags=re.I).strip(" -")
if stripped and stripped not in variants:
variants.append(stripped)
# Soft punctuation cleanup
soft = re.sub(r"[^\w\s+#.+]", " ", core)
soft = re.sub(r"\s+", " ", soft).strip()
if soft and soft not in variants:
variants.append(soft)
return variants


def lookup_cover(book: dict) -> str:
title = book["title"]
edition = book.get("edition") or ""

for q in query_variants(title):
for mode in ("q", "title"):
try:
docs = search_openlibrary(q, mode=mode)
except Exception as exc: # noqa: BLE001
print(f" warn: search failed for {book['id']!r} ({mode}): {exc}")
time.sleep(0.6)
continue
url = pick_cover_url(docs, title, edition)
if url:
return url
time.sleep(REQUEST_PAUSE)
return ""


def main() -> None:
books = load_json(BOOKS_PATH, [])
cache = load_json(CACHE_PATH, {})

# Retry previously empty cache entries.
pending = [b for b in books if not (b.get("coverImage") or "").strip()]
for b in pending:
cache.pop(b["id"], None)

print(f"Books total: {len(books)}")
print(f"Pending lookups: {len(pending)}")

done = 0
found = 0
missing = 0

def worker(book: dict) -> tuple[str, str]:
time.sleep(REQUEST_PAUSE)
return book["id"], lookup_cover(book)

with ThreadPoolExecutor(max_workers=MAX_WORKERS) as pool:
futures = {pool.submit(worker, b): b for b in pending}
for fut in as_completed(futures):
book = futures[fut]
try:
book_id, url = fut.result()
except Exception as exc: # noqa: BLE001
print(f"error: {book['id']}: {exc}")
book_id, url = book["id"], ""
cache[book_id] = url
if url:
book["coverImage"] = url
found += 1
else:
missing += 1
done += 1
if done % 20 == 0 or done == len(pending):
save_json(CACHE_PATH, cache)
save_json(BOOKS_PATH, books)
print(f"progress {done}/{len(pending)} found={found} missing={missing}")

save_json(CACHE_PATH, cache)
save_json(BOOKS_PATH, books)
filled = sum(1 for b in books if (b.get("coverImage") or "").strip())
print(f"Done. Covers filled: {filled}/{len(books)}")


if __name__ == "__main__":
main()
